After dropping the first look at "Dishonored 2" during Bethesda's 2016 E3 press conference, Bethesda has officially revealed what fans should look forward to when they avail of the pre-order deal and collector's edition.

True Achievements posted the list of thefeatures of the collector's edition of "Dishonored 2." These include:

  • A 13.5" (H) x 6" (W) x 5.5" (D) Replica of Corvo Attano's Mask and Stand.
  • A wearable replica of Emily Kaldwin's ring and a premium display box made from zinc alloy.
  • A limited edition full color print of the Propaganda Poster from the infamous Propaganda Office of Karnaca.
  • Exclusive collectible "Legacy" Metal Case decorated with the portraits of Empress Emily Kaldwin and the Royal Protector Corvo Attano.

The "Dishonored 2" collector's edition will also come out with the Digital Imperial Assassin's pack that will allow players to earn exclusive bonecharms such as the Duelist's Luck and Void Favor. This pack will also let them explore some of the game's new lore and art that include an Antique Serkonan Guitar as well as the book "Goodbye, Karnaca – A Musician's Farewall." This pack also comes with 500 coins that can be used to purchase new gear and weapons that can be found in the illegal black market shops.

Also, the special collector's edition of the game will be packed with the digital remastered copy of the "Dishonored: Definitive Edition" for the PlayStation 4 and Xbox One.

Meanwhile, the latest gameplay trailer for "Dishonored 2" shows that most of the events in the game will be held in Karnaca. It also reveals that Emily Kaldwin and Corvo Attano allows players to finish the game without the use of any special powers through the Flesh and Steel mode.

Bethesda is expected to release "Dishonored 2" on the PlayStation 4, Xbox One, and PC on Nov. 11.
